5 Common Misconceptions About AI Phone Screening That Recruiters Must Address

5 Common Misconceptions About AI Phone Screening That Recruiters Must Address (2026)

In 2026, AI phone screening is more than just a buzzword; it's a transformative tool that can enhance recruitment efficiency. However, despite its growing prevalence, misconceptions persist that can hinder its adoption. For instance, a recent study found that 67% of HR leaders still believe AI screening lacks the personal touch essential for candidate engagement. This article will debunk five common myths about AI phone screening, illustrating how addressing these misconceptions can lead to more effective talent acquisition strategies.

1. AI Phone Screening Replaces Human Interaction

One of the most prevalent myths is that AI phone screening replaces human recruiters. In reality, AI serves as an augmentation tool. According to a 2025 report from the Society for Human Resource Management, organizations that integrated AI phone screening saw a 30% increase in recruiter productivity. By automating initial screenings, recruiters can focus on high-value activities, such as building relationships and assessing cultural fit.

2. AI Screening is Impersonal and Cold

Many recruiters fear that AI phone screenings create an impersonal experience for candidates. However, data from NTRVSTA shows that AI phone screening can achieve a 95% candidate completion rate, significantly higher than the 40-60% completion rates associated with asynchronous video interviews. The real-time interaction of phone screenings allows candidates to feel heard and valued, while AI ensures a consistent evaluation process.

3. AI Phone Screening is Just a Passing Trend

Skeptics often view AI phone screening as a short-lived trend. Yet, the numbers tell a different story. The global AI recruitment market is projected to grow from $1.3 billion in 2020 to $10 billion by 2027, according to a report from ResearchAndMarkets. This growth indicates that organizations are increasingly recognizing the value of AI in streamlining recruitment processes and improving candidate experiences.

4. AI Screening is Only for Large Organizations

There is a misconception that only large enterprises can benefit from AI phone screening due to perceived costs and complexity. In fact, NTRVSTA offers scalable solutions with pricing tiers starting as low as $500 per month, making AI phone screening accessible for small to medium-sized businesses. Companies in sectors such as healthcare and retail, which often face high-volume hiring needs, can particularly benefit from AI-driven efficiencies.

5. AI Cannot Adapt to Different Languages or Cultures

A common belief is that AI phone screening lacks the flexibility to handle diverse linguistic and cultural contexts. In contrast, NTRVSTA's platform supports over nine languages, including Spanish, Portuguese, and Mandarin, allowing organizations to conduct screenings that resonate with a broader candidate pool. This multilingual capability is especially critical in global markets, where inclusivity can significantly enhance employer branding.
